Alkaline water has changed the lives of millions of people around the world. Water filtration is the process of removing unwanted chemicals and also the biological contaminants from water. Generally water is purified for drinking purposes, but can also be purified for other purposes like to meet the medical and industrial use. Water filtration is a physical process of purifying drinking water and it is normally a common method used by the majority of people. Drinking water is normally purified to reduce the concentration of unwanted components like suspended particles, bacteria, fungi etc that might be harmful to your health.
You cannot gage whether or not water is of good quality just by visual examination. Boiling or filters are not enough for water treatment and all the contaminants that might be contained in it. Not all water is healthy water; therefore you must take proper precaution in ensuring that you drink treated water for it is good for your health.
There are various ways of treating your water; one of them is by pumping and containment. For majority of water it should be pumped from the source or aided into pipes or storage tanks. These physical infrastructures meant for holding water should be constructed using appropriate materials so as to avoid adding the contaminants to the water again.
Distilled water normally has a pH of 7.0 (neutral), it is neither alkaline nor acidic. Water pH is used in determining the acidity of the water whereby sea water has a Ph of 8.3 which is slightly alkaline. Acid water is lower than pH 7.0 and thus lime or soda ash is normally added to increase the pH. Of the two, lime is more common since it is cheap, but it also makes the water hard. The water should be made to be slightly alkaline so that coagulation and flocculation work effectively and also help in reducing the risk of lead being dissolved from lead pipes.
Filtration is the final step in getting rid of the remaining suspended particles and unsettled floc in your water. One of the common water filters is the rapid sand filter which allows water to move vertically through sand which has a layer of activated carbon or anthracite coal on top of the sand. When cleaning this type of filter, water is run quickly upwards through the filter, in the opposite direction. This method of cleaning is commonly referred to as backflushing or backwashing.
